Engine oil pressure G
If the message "STOP! ENGINE
OIL PRESSURE" appears in the
Check Control: stop the vehicle and
switch off the engine immediately.
Check the engine oil level; top up as
required. If the oil level is correct:
please contact the nearest BMW
center.
Do not continue driving. The
engine could be damaged
because of inadequate lubrication.<

Antilock Brake System (ABS) G
ABS has been deactivated in
response to a system malfunc-
tion. Conventional braking efficiency is
available without limitations. Please
have the system inspected by your
BMW center.

Please fasten safety belts G
An acoustical signal is sounded
and a message appears in the
Check Control for 4 to 8 seconds. The
acoustical signal ends when the belt is
fastened.

Green: for your information
Blue: for your information
Turn signal indicator
Flashes when the turn signals
are in operation. Rapid flashing
means there is a fault in the system.

High beams
Comes on when the high beams
are on or the headlamp flasher
is actuated.

Cruise control
Comes on when the cruise
control is activated: available for
operation via the multifunction steering
wheel.
